Everton sign Belgian Onana from Lille
Everton have signed Belgian international midfielder Amadou Onana from French Ligue 1 side Lille on a five-year contract, the Premier League club said on Tuesday.

The Toffees were left short of defenders after both Ben Godfrey and Yerry Mina were injured during a 1-0 defeat by Chelsea in their opening match of the new league season on Saturday. This move sees Wolves captain Coady, 29, returning to his home city eight years after leaving Liverpool, where he came through the Anfield club's academy. "It's incredible to join Everton," Coady told his new club's website.
